A post medieval silver halfgroat of Elizabeth I (AD1558-1603) dating to AD 1583-1585. E D G ROSA SINE SPINA obverse depicting a crowned bust facing left with two pellets behind the head. CIVITAS LONDON reverse depicting a square shield on a long cross fourchee. Initial mark A. Mint of London. North vol 2, p 137, no 2016.

A silver Post-Medieval halfgroat of Henry VIII (AD 1509-47) dating to the period AD 1526 - 1532. Second issue. Royal shield over long cross fourchee reverse, W to left and A to right of shield. Mint of Canterbury under Archbishop William Warham. T initial mark.
North Vol 2, p.112, no.1802.
